Land for Sale in Martin County, Texas

A total of almost 2,000 acres were listed for sale in Martin County recently; the combined value of all Martin County land for sale was almost $13 million. Martin County ranks 189th in the Lone Star State for the total acreage of land currently advertised for sale. Of all land and rural real estate for sale in Martin County, Stanton featured the most land for sale. Agriculture and farming drives the Martin County economy, with 414 farms recorded in the county during the U.S. Census in 2012. Farming activities in Martin County generate annual revenues of $19 million, most of which is from crops. Martin County is the 135th largest county (915 square miles) in Texas. It's located in the South Plains Texas region of Texas.

Land Market Insights and Pricing in Martin County, Texas

On average, land listings in Martin County, TX have a lot size of 127 acres and are priced around $542,088. The median price per acre in Martin County, TX is $8,999.
